The Role of Responsive Web Design in Digital Marketing
In today's digital landscape, responsive web design is more than just a trend; it is a necessity. As mobile usage continues to rise, businesses must adapt their websites to provide a seamless experience across all devices. This article discusses the pivotal role responsive web design plays in digital marketing.
1. Improved User Experience
A responsive website adjusts seamlessly to various screen sizes, ensuring users have a positive experience regardless of the device they are using. This improved user experience leads to higher engagement and lower bounce rates.
2. Enhanced SEO Performance
Search engines favor responsive websites, as they provide a better experience for mobile users. This can lead to improved search rankings, making it easier for potential customers to find your brand online.
3. Increased Conversion Rates
Responsive web design can significantly impact conversion rates. When users can easily navigate your site on any device, they are more likely to complete desired actions, such as making a purchase or signing up for a newsletter.
4. Cost-Effective Maintenance
Managing a single responsive site is more cost-effective than maintaining separate desktop and mobile versions. This can save your business time and resources in the long run.
5. Staying Ahead of Competitors
With the increasing emphasis on mobile browsing, businesses that do not adopt responsive design risk falling behind. Implementing a responsive design strategy can give your brand a competitive edge in the digital market.
Conclusion
Responsive web design is integral to successful digital marketing. By prioritizing it, your brand can enhance user engagement, improve SEO, and ultimately boost conversion rates.
